Dwarvish

The dwarves have a rough well structured language that is all work and no frills. Specific ideas and words are created by combining more general words together. For example a wizard is a "magic wielding person" while a cleric would be a "gods magic wielding person". There can be a word for anything it just might be very long. While all dwarves know Dwarvish, it has a few distinct dialects.
  • Renlarch
  • Sozarian
  • Undermountain
  While they are similar enough that a Dwarvish speaker who knows the Westreach dialect can understand someone speaking Undermountain they are different enough that communication is often problematic.  

Renlarch

The most common Dwarvish dialect. Almost all dwarves speak speak this dialect. When people think of Dwarvish this is what comes to mind.  

Sozarian

This dialect is much rougher than Renlarch and is spoken only by the Snow Dwarves of Sozar. They have many unique phrases and an accent that is nigh incomprehensible.  

Undermountain

Very few speak this dialect. It is rarely heard or spoken on the surface. The Grey Dwarves speak Undermountain and to them it is considered the original Dwarvish.
